# Cold storage archiver client setup.
#
# Heads up: this client talks to Frostbin, our internal archival service.
# Anything in a bucket tagged `tier:cold` and untouched for 180 days gets
# zipped and shipped to the Frostbin vault — don't point this at hot
# buckets or you'll have a bad week restoring them. Retries are handled
# by the Burrow queue, so don't add your own retry loop here.
# The client needs the Frostbin service key, pasted just below.

gateway credential: zpat15_lMLOSdhT94y0U3l

Subject: Welcome to on-call — and a heads-up on Queuebert

Hey, welcome aboard! Quick context before your first shift: we're mid-migration off our homegrown job queue (Queuebert) onto the new broker. Until cutover finishes, both systems run side by side, so duplicate-job alerts are expected and usually harmless — just confirm idempotency markers before acking. Anything stuck longer than an hour, fail it over manually to the new broker. The migration status, failover steps, and known quirks are all tracked on the page here.

operations page: https://jenkins.zemvarcloud.local/job/merge_requests/repo/build/73930b4b30f0a8ed

BRIEFING — Leadership Review: Write-Down, Norvale Components

Facts: 9,800 units of the Arcten valve line written down. Cause: failed re-certification after the supplier switch. Book impact: within the provision set last quarter. Remedy: supplier contract terminated; replacement sourcing underway via the Delmere plant. Audit trail complete; no restatement required. No press interest expected. Recommendation: note and close. One item for board eyes only follows below.

management briefing: Jorixax Holdings is in early talks to buy Casixax Holdings for about $420.3 million. The Fenmir launch date is October 27, and nothing goes to the press before then. Legal wants the Keloxek Foods term sheet redrafted before April 16.

Q3 Planning Note — Finance Team

Effective immediately: hiring freeze across the Tarnwell Systems integration division. All open requisitions cancelled; backfills require CFO sign-off. Contractor spend capped at current run rate. Payroll forecasts should assume flat headcount through Q1. Exceptions limited to safety-critical roles only. No external communication. Rationale and next steps are set out in the note below.

board note of fahif-yahog: Gross margin on Wenath came in at 10 percent against a plan of 5 percent. Only 3 of the 100 pilot accounts renewed Wenath, so a churn review is set for July 15.